Web13 Feb 2024 · The owner of an LLC taxed as a Sole Proprietorship will pay self-employment taxes on all profits in the company. For simplicity, self-employment taxes are 15.3% of net income (income after expenses). So if a single-member LLC has $100,000 in net income, the owner will pay $15,300 in self-employment tax. http://www.employeridentificationnumber.net/how-to-correct-information-on-a-filed-ein-application.html Web28 May 2024 · This means you can't really "cancel" an EIN.
